Comment on the Meadow Drive and Downing Street/Butner Road pedestrian improvement projects through an online open house through July 25.

The Meadow Drive Pedestrian Improvement Project includes new sidewalks, filling in gaps along the east side of the road, between Pioneer and Walker Roads. This project, estimated at $830,000, is funded by House Bill 2017.

The Downing Street/Butner Road Pedestrian Improvement Project also involves new sidewalk, filling in gaps along the south side of the road, between Murray Boulevard and Meadow Drive. This project, estimated at $1.9 million, is funded by both House Bill 2017 and Gain Share.

Both projects were selected by the Urban Road Maintenance Advisory Committee (URMDAC) based on the need for safe pedestrian routes in this area.
